In which year was the Liberalised Remittance Scheme (LRS
scheme) introduced by the RBI?Solution
The Liberalised Remittance Scheme (LRS scheme) of the RBI was introduced in 2004, under which, all resident individuals, including minors, are allowed to freely remit up to $250,000 per financial year for any permissible current or capital account transaction or a combination of both. The scheme was introduced on February 4, 2004, with a limit of $25,000.
